Training requirements
Security guards are responsible for ensuring the safety of the public. They are typically employed by private security firms. These guards are required to undergo training. The type of training required is based on the type of position being filled.
A typical security guard position requires 16 to 40 hours of training. Training programs include courses on basic security and criminology. They also may include specialized training for a particular assignment.
To become a security guard, applicants must pass a background check and meet the requirements for physical fitness. Applicants must also pass fingerprint checks.
New York security guards must register with the state’s Department of State. Applicants will receive a certificate of registration. Obtaining this certificate demonstrates that the applicant is qualified for a security guard license.
Guards are usually required to be at least 18 years of age and United States citizens. In addition, guards must undergo fingerprint screening and pass a criminal record check.
For armed guards, the training requirements are more stringent. They must have an 8 Hour Pre-Assignment Training Course and 16 Hour In Service Training Course. Armied guards must also have a valid NYS pistol permit.

The process of obtaining a security guard license can vary from state to state. Some states require a certain amount of classroom and field training. For example, in Alabama, applicants must complete eight hours of classroom training. In Alaska, candidates must complete 40 hours of on-the-job training within 180 days of employment.
